1.1 Overview of the Fluke 179 True-RMS Multimeter

The Fluke 179 True-RMS multimeter is a high-precision, battery-powered device designed for measuring electrical and electronic systems. It features a 6000-count, 3 3/4-digit LCD display and a bar graph for visual feedback. With CAT III 1000V and CAT IV 600V safety ratings, it ensures safe operation in hazardous environments. The multimeter supports manual and auto-ranging modes, offering flexibility for various measurements, including voltage, current, resistance, capacitance, and temperature. Its durability and advanced features make it an essential tool for professionals.

3.1 Unpacking and Inventory

When unpacking the Fluke 179 multimeter, ensure all components are included: the multimeter, 4mm test leads with protective caps, a 9V battery, thermocouple, user manual, and protective holster. Inspect each item for damage or defects. Verify the battery is correctly installed and the test leads are securely connected. Familiarize yourself with the meter’s front panel, including the display, rotary switch, and input jacks. Organize the accessories and store them in a safe place to prevent loss or damage.

3.2 Battery Installation and Maintenance

The Fluke 179 multimeter operates on a 9V battery. To install, open the battery compartment, ensuring correct polarity. Replace the battery when measurements become inconsistent or the display dims. Store the multimeter with the battery removed if unused for extended periods to prevent leakage. Avoid extreme temperatures and physical stress. Use alkaline batteries for optimal performance and longer life. Regularly inspect the compartment for corrosion and clean if necessary to maintain reliable operation.

4.5 Temperature Measurement

The Fluke 179 multimeter includes a built-in thermocouple input for precise temperature measurement, supporting common thermocouple types like K-type probes. It provides high accuracy and resolution for temperature readings, making it ideal for HVAC, industrial, and automotive applications. The meter offers a wide temperature range and automatic or manual scaling for versatility. With CAT III and CAT IV safety ratings, it ensures safe operation during temperature testing. The bar graph display adds visual feedback for monitoring temperature changes, while manual and auto-ranging modes enhance measurement convenience.

7.1 Identifying and Resolving Measurement Errors

Measurement errors with the Fluke 179 can often be traced to incorrect range settings or improper probe connections. Check for loose leads, damaged cables, or incorrect input jacks. Ensure the multimeter is set to the correct mode (DC/AC) and range for the measurement. If the display shows “OL,” the measured value exceeds the selected range. Use autorange or manually adjust the range for accurate readings. Calibration issues or battery depletion may also cause inaccuracies, requiring recalibration or battery replacement. Always refer to the manual for specific error code interpretations and solutions.

7.2 Understanding Error Messages

The Fluke 179 displays error messages like “OL” for overload or low battery warnings. “OL” indicates the measured value exceeds the selected range, requiring a higher range or autorange. Battery symbols signal low power, needing replacement. Calibration errors or faulty fuses may also trigger alerts. Refer to the manual for specific error code interpretations. Addressing these issues ensures accurate measurements and prevents damage. Always resolve errors promptly to maintain reliability and safety during troubleshooting tasks with the multimeter.

8.1 Fluke’s Lifetime Limited Warranty

Fluke’s Lifetime Limited Warranty ensures the 179 multimeter is free from defects in material and workmanship for its entire service life. This comprehensive coverage reflects Fluke’s commitment to quality, providing users with peace of mind. The warranty applies to all Fluke DMM series, including the 20, 70, 80, 170, 180, and 280 models, reinforcing trust in their reliability and durability for professional use.
